“The webpage is not available,” “Temporarily down,” or “The site has been permanently moved to a new web address” error irritates users the most on Google Chrome. The desired webpages do not load smoothly and, in turn, consume their valuable time. But why does this happen? If you look closely, you will find the reason written on the screen: ERR_QUIC_PROTOCOL_ERROR.


ERR_QUIC_PROTOCOL_ERROR is one of the errors you face while working on Chrome. It indicates an error related to Quick UDP Internet Connections (QUIC), a protocol by Google Chrome to support low-latency transportation, enhance graphics for games and improve video streaming while keeping the data connections secure and encrypted.

Read Also:

  1. Confirm Form Resubmission
  2. Widevine Content Decryption Module
  3. Error Loading Player: No Playable Sources Found


Causes of the ERR_QUIC_PROTOCOL_ERROR in Chrome

As already mentioned, it is due to the Quick UDP Internet Connections (QUIC) protocol by Google. Besides QUIC, the third-party extensions are another reason for ERR_QUIC_PROTOCOL_ERROR in chrome. Third-party extensions are a part of the software that is not created by the makers of the Browser.

Although extensions prove beneficial for the inclusion of new features, they can also have technical glitches that hamper browsing. Disabling or deleting is one way to fix the error in Chrome discussed in detail in this article. (See Method 2)

7 Ways to Fix ERR_QUIC_PROTOCOL_ERROR in Chrome

When you see the error on your webpage, the first thing is to try another web browser like Mozilla Firefox or Internet Explorer. If the page does not load from another browser as well, the problem is on the webpage or with your internet connection. There is no issue with Google Chrome.

If the webpage opens from another browser, you need to fix the ERR_QUIC_PROTOCOL_ERROR in Google Chrome. We have compiled a list of 7 methods that are quite helpful in fixing ERR_QUIC_PROTOCOL_ERROR in Chrome:

Method 1: Using the Chrome://flag Command

The root cause of ERR_QUIC_PROTOCOL_ERROR is the QUIC protocol. Outlined to make the web traffic faster and safer, QUIC has reduced connection time for users. When you change your network connection from Wi-Fi to say, 3G or 4G data pack or vice-versa, QUIC allows a smoother reestablishment of network. However, QUIC is still in its experimental stages and can cause ERR_QUIC_PROTOCOL_ERROR. So, to get rid of the problem, you can disable the QUIC protocol altogether.

The following are the steps to disable QUIC:

Step 1: Open Google Chrome from your desktop and go to a new tab.

Step 2: Type chrome://flag in the Address Bar and press Enter.

Step 3: As soon as you press Enter, you will see a page with WARNING. However, you do not have to worry as it is safe. Hence, ignore the Warning message.

Step 4: Scroll down and find the Experimental QUIC Protocol feature.

Step 5: In case you are unable to find, go to the search box or press Ctrl + F and type Experimental QUIC Protocol and press Enter.

Step 6: After you have identified the feature, click Disabled from the drop-down box. The feature has been disabled. Restart your Google Chrome now and check.

If the problem persists, look for other methods mentioned below.

Method 2: Disable Browser Extensions

As discussed earlier, the other cause of ERR_QUIC_PROTOCOL_ERROR in Chrome is the third-party extensions. The following are the steps to disable the browser extensions:

Step 1: Go to Google Chrome and open a new tab.

Step 2: Go to Address Bar and type Chrome://Extensions and press Enter.

Step 3: Now go to the extension that you think is creating the issue and disable it.

Step 4: Restart your computer. If the problem is still there, it is suggested you delete the extension.

Method 3: Resetting the Browser

When you reset Chrome, it resets all the unwanted changes in your browser. Please note that resetting your browser can clear a lot of your data except saved bookmarks, passwords, and text settings.

Therefore, it is commendable if you save all the prominent links before proceeding with the following steps:

Step 1: Open Google Chrome and click on the three dots on the screen’s top-right corner.

Step 2: Click on Settings.

Step 3: Go to the Advanced settings option.

Step 4: Click on the Reset and Clean up option.

Step 5: Relaunch Google Chrome to see if ERR_QUIC_PROTOCOL_ERROR is solved or not. If the error remains, try other methods.

Method 4: Checking the Proxy or Firewall Settings

Both Proxy and Firewall prevent unauthorized connections to your network. However, proxy and firewall are not the same; they have a huge difference.

A proxy is a program that makes an indirect communication between the user and the server by creating a wall between a local network and the outside network. On the other hand, a firewall program blocks the unauthorized connections between a local network and any other exterior network. This indeed could be one of the reasons you are not able to access certain sites on Google Chrome and facing the ERR_QUIC_PROTOCOL_ERROR.

To fix the error, all you must do is follow these simple steps:

Step 1: Press Windows key and R together. You’ll see a Run box in the bottom left corner of your screen.

Step 2: Type inetcpl.cpl and press Enter. You’ll see a Network Settings box. Alternatively, you can go to Control Panel and click on the Network and Internet option.

Step 3: Click on Connection and then click LAN Settings.

Step 4: In the Automatic Configuration, check the Automatically detect settings option.

Step 5: In the Proxy Server, uncheck the Use a proxy server for your LAN (These settings will not apply to dial-up or VPN connections) option.

Step 5: Press Enter, click on Apply.

Step 6: Restart your computer system.

Method 5: Temporarily Disable the Firewall

If you have tried the above methods but, none of them worked for you, it is always good to check whether you can access the site after temporarily disabling the firewall on your Windows or Mac. If yes, this is the method for you. Follow the below-given steps to disable the Firewall on Windows PC:

Step 1: Check the anti-virus program in your system and disable it for some time.

Step 2: Go back to Google Chrome and try to access the site.

Step 3: If you are still not able to access the site, Go to Control Panel. Click on the first option- System and Security.

Step 4: Select Windows Firewall and select Turn Windows on or off.

Step 5: Choose the option to turn off the firewall and restart. Do not forget to turn on the firewall afterward.

You can also disable the Firewall on your MAC by following the given steps:

Step 1: Go to System Preferences by clicking on the Apple icon on the top left corner.

Step 2: Click on Security and Privacy option.

Step 3: Open the Firewall tab.

Step 4: On the bottom of the screen, click on the Click on the lock to make changes option.

Step 5: Enter your Administrator Password and click Unlock.

Step 6: Click on the Turn off Firewall. Now, your firewall settings are disabled. Try again to reach the site, and do not forget to turn on the Firewall afterward.

Method 6: Scan for Virus

As we all know, viruses are troublesome for our personal computers. They can infect the system in multiple ways and cause substantial damage. The most common source of any virus can be downloadable files containing malware, pirated software, internet, or even CDs.

In response to the increasing virus attacks, a lot of anti-virus software has been launched over the years. If you still have not downloaded the software, you should do it now to prevent your information from reaching the wrong hands and scan your system regularly for viruses and clean it.

Following are the steps you should follow to scan for viruses to fix ERR_QUIC_PROTOCOL_ERROR in Chrome:

Step 1: Go to your Windows Anti-virus program or any other you’ve installed on your computer.

Step 2: Click on Scan and wait until the scan is complete.

Step 3: If there is any virus in your system, follow the steps mentioned there to delete it.

Step 4: Now, try again to access the site.

Method 7: Disable VPN

VPN stands for Virtual Private Network; it ensures the user’s privacy by creating a private internet connection. It helps to keep the data secure by protecting it from the eyes of public Wi-Fi. VPN hides your browsing history, IP address, location, and all your devices from the general connection. However, VPN can cause errors and uncertainty, together with ERR_QUIC_PROTOCOL_ERROR in Chrome. The following are the steps to disable VPN:

Step 1: Go to Control Panel. Click on the Internet and Network.

Step 2: Go to the VPN.

Step 3: Click on the Disconnect or Disable option. Now, you can check whether you can access the site or not.

If VPN is the reason for ERR_QUIC_PROTOCOL_ERROR, then you should search for a substitute for your VPN software.

Read Also:

  1. M7703-1003
  2. WebGL Hit A Snag
  3. This Site Can’t Be Reached


While you can’t predict why ERR_QUIC_PROTOCOL_ERROR is occurring on Chrome on your system, you can always try to fix it. The above-written methods provide step by step procedure to resolve the issue real quick. We hope this article helps, and you have a significant change in your browsing experience ahead.

In case you are still unable to connect to the site on Google Chrome, try to contact Google Customer Support for further help.